Wages in Manufacturing in Chile increased to 115.79 points in June from 115.68 points in May of 2025. Wages in Manufacturing in Chile averaged 119.98 points from 2009 until 2025, reaching an all time high of 161.52 points in March of 2024 and a record low of 97.75 points in February of 2016. source: National Institute of Statistics, Chile
Wages in Manufacturing in Chile is expected to be 115.85 points by the end of this quarter, according to Trading Economics global macro models and analysts expectations. In the long-term, the Chile Hourly Wages in Manufacturing Index is projected to trend around 120.60 points in 2026 and 124.21 points in 2027, according to our econometric models.
